



免费预览已结束,剩余1页可下载查看
下载本文档
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
泽枪被习敦林舵裸求籽的吕钞怠竖袖黄脉颤煽拳裔氯劈艾聪系貉婪鄂惰么箱昏辉邵灌铡年亦券坝芽鸳爹念绣娥蛇早惦怂眯宫还佰鞠肌晰舅系攘膘醒猫抉蝇彭略崩察象蒸戮涟翅凰主读泪随却赢头治糯预傀铃蜡叫忱纵迫钝色德衫纷诅档均若胃产檬展讲始复瓶怖沂舱骏旭挖碍诞酞钥镜闯扼疤唆疥割耽潮械尧弟丝捍毙乾桓逐皋撼霹绝柠坎赚惨烩吕澄灭褥辣级命壹猩咱索蚀靛乍铬楼奄宪五渡奇牟然萌坚桔冗霸梭鹃栽且凸矿范脓晃缠客邱剐陀祁帘嵌拄九模二旅淤躬豆疆权洞夹钠啸瞩汛机狠唆郑吻暗州晦窘没菩崇求耀脯敝裴己蜒铺纷肩珐朋弹瘦涝呻已差榜修臼撕健旭廷逮防菩浸拽僚洱残谰骆IEEE 802.11的载波侦听技术分析2 IEEE 802.11的载波侦听技术分析摘要 作为一种MAC层接入控制协议,载波侦听多路访问冲突避免(Carrier Sense Multiple Access with Collision Avoi量无胯篮努筋云凛扔终茫益更汇革刃俊顷赣蛛肠买哇描湃则仅骨陇虑骡测念刘羞困前率啤自糜峨真段伟讲吃狡族仅纷阵纂槐蚂沂彬曾呕坞竖递蕉驻薛码施旷羌溪曼柄剪兜惹毅霸狗两砰逊狡睛销芒椒眠解詹绞抽郎风维爷录停旱邵雀创唾槽嘎赣脊知栓婿岗晦晨匹奶垃步迁津表菊娜跃殉架奖夸俐炙辞保磋摘垄缩雾薄呸瞅伍妹舔刀土迂大污侠凌渺杨娜已蹬惰元死脏几射粳穿萧踩沟妇窥赃鸭摆戳董盛啡霜辈佃铃松牲裸尔曝替栏选耿龋筑篱誊同发奋某秩剩镀反迁妓八孩宅肚毋膀喉祝嫌括复磺镜业宴览赂珊野肠毛凉离瘟蜡沥识闺厄输葫洽秽浚枫汾侣全息罢滦相寄史帮待寐嫌徘租挎躲钻墙涩隘IEEE802.11的载波侦听技术分析耀洪吊迢隘奥浅传铅敲焙跺京讼忻弱喧蹬尝扣抬投挽搓掏讨呸醋沼捆复窜弄泡插爸竖墅霹滓嘱峡丧景言抡橇佬蜘塑和听炉载桩炳篷辰灵淄湍幸核志暖咨好恍冯蚁甸夺乃版含渤床芋食獭坟拆敦捅谱窜韵军斧绊练踩踌晶萌瑶瞅颊叹坯恬多笆毁仰试孵迄跑温灌水潍扭缝乎仟醋材垒溺棺位胁幻皑票耍叮挣痈溃设支晓盈宫盐莲客济晚媳角扩溃裂凸降浴兼拷抿疑匠钎商且馁雇勒殊邱啼孔兜放墩质仅槛捕妹魁源五咨晴斥誊董辫泵夜迹痞豪断蒙复洛媳腥规锨霉豌尾咏番默唆赦螺吉哼眯渡襟折惮卖平秸躯炔龚搪宾努肇菱俄蔚瓶摇菊酌呻搅决擦忙廊徐可巾擞碎玩奴案促嗅晨谈撇韦弄俯柯犁杖试犹腆IEEE 802.11的载波侦听技术分析摘要 作为一种MAC层接入控制协议,载波侦听多路访问冲突避免(Carrier Sense Multiple Access with Collision Avoid, CSMA/CA)协议已经成功应用在IEEE802.11无线局域网络(Wireless Local Area Network, WLAN)中。CSMA协议最基本的行为就是载波侦听。但是在无线局域网中,单纯在物理层难以实现有效侦听。因此IEEE802.11采用物理载波侦听与虚拟载波侦听。本文详细讨论后者的运行机制。关键词 IEEE802.11; 载波侦听; 网络分配向量ABSTRACT As a MAC layer Access control protocol, Carrier protected reliably against detective multi-channel Access/conflict Carrier Sense Multiple Access to Avoid (account and Collision, CSMA/CA) agreement has successfully applied in Wireless Local Area Network (IEEE802.11 Wireless Local Area in a Wireless local-area Network (WLAN).The most basic behavior of CSMA protocol is carrier sense.But in a Wireless local-area Network,the sense is difficult to be effective only in physical layer.Thus IEEE802.11 adopt physical sense and virtual sense.This paper discuss the latter how to work.KEYWORD IEEE802.11 Carrier Sense Network Allocation Vector 1. IEEE802.11 1.1 IEEE802.11网络结构IEEE802.11规定了两种网络组成方式:Ad hoc模式与AP模式。Ad hoc为无中心单跳网,网络不存在中心借点,所有无线站点在网络拓扑中地位平等,站点之间可以并且只能直接通信。802.11标准中的Ad hoc模式可以构成最简单的工作组级无线网络,特别适合于临时性的工作组使用。有中心结构的无线网络存在一个中心节点,802.11将此节点成为AP点,所以此种模式成为AP模式。网络可以通过AP连入上一级网络。1.2 CSMA/CA CSMA/CA协议是无线局域网的MAC子层的最主要的协议。CSMA/CA协议中的基本访问方法是WLAN上的站点用以确定自身是否可以在共享的WM上实施传输的核心机制,协议中还采用的一系列辅助增强算法则是提高共享有效性的重要辅助机制。1.3时隙与帧间隔 802.11标准中的CSMA/CA协议是一种时隙式CSMA协议。为了协调各个站点对WM的访问,要求同一BSS内的所有站点都同步各自的时间基准,使得所有站点的MAC协议可以有序执行。 所有站点都只能在时隙的起点启动发送过程,这样可以将站点间的访问冲突概率降低大约一半。站点的访问失败时也只能在时隙起点启动随机后退过程,这样也可以降低站点间的重发冲突带来的危害。在所有基于分组的网络中,分组的传输必须留有适当的时间间隔以保证前后分组不会重贴而相互干扰,在共享信道的网络中更是如此。这个时间间隔就是帧间间隔Inter Frame Space,IFS 在802.11中,IFS发展成了WLAN的一个重要的参数。IFS值的大小具有优先级的含义。原始的IFS值用于决定无线站点察觉到无线介质变成空闲时仍然需要等待发射的时间间隔。 802.11一共使用了5中IFS,这5种帧间间隔分别是:SIFS, 短IFS,具有最短间隔值;PIFS,PCF IFS,具有次短间隔值;DIFS,DCF IFS,具有一般间隔值;AIFS,仲裁用IFS,具有较长间隔值;EIFS,扩展IFS,具有最长间隔值。2.载波侦听 CSMA/CA协议的最基本行为就是载波侦听。 在无线局域网中,站点确定无线介质的占用状态并不是一件非常容易的事,站点单纯在物理层难以实现有效的载波侦听。因此,802.11标准使用物理载波侦听和虚拟载波侦听两种方法,并综合这两种得到的结果判定无线介质的占用状态。2.1物理级侦听 802.11标准在物理级中使用了信道空闲评估(clear channel assessmentCCA)技术对物理信道进行侦听,这是物理层载波侦听的功能,用以确定WM的当前占用状态。 具体的CCA方法与物理层采用的技术密切相关。例如:在使用DSS技术的物理层执行CCA的方式,通常是检测到DSSS信号且ED超限,其中的接受能量检测超限是对接收天线收到的信号能量进行检测并据此做出相应的判断。2.2 MAC虚拟侦听2.2.1 RTS/CTS机制 无线网络比较难以解决的一个问题是隐蔽站问题,即发送站点检测不到另一个站点也在发送数据,因而在接收站发生碰撞。为了解决隐蔽站为题,引入了RTS/CTS机制。每个站点在访问介质时,获得介质控制的站并不是直接发送数据帧而是向接收站发送RTS帧,接收站回复一个CTS帧。其他非RTS目的站接收RTS帧之后,读取其中的传输时间预留信息,也就是网络分配矢量(NAV),并更新本地NAV,收到CTS帧的非CTS目的站点也同样读取NAV信息,并更新本地NAV,这样无论是位于发送站传播范围的站点还是接收站传播范围的站点,都能知晓介质已经被占用。2.2.2 NAV 虚拟侦听是MAC子层的功能。802.11标准使用网络分配向量(Network Allocation VectorNAV)实现虚拟侦听。 MAC帧中的Dur/ID字段中存放着的“持续时间”,用于发射该帧的无线站点向监听该无线信道的所有站点通告自己预估的“本次发射”持续时间。由于在802.11中使用了多片连发、单帧等待确认等技术,所以“本次发射”是指标准规定的、不应当被中断的、多片连发交互序列。 这个持续时间是有CSMA/CA协议针对共享的WM环境分配的、传输一个由多个分量构成的“网络向量”所使用的,因此命名为“网络分配向量”。每个无线站点维护自身的NAV变量,根据对WM的预计占用时间及时更新NAV,并将最新的NAV值放入待发送的Dur/ID字段,使当前的NAV值向全网通告自己根据CSMA/CA协议而分配到的对WM的占用时间。所有收到NAV的站点则根据收到帧中的NAV值,认为“虚拟的”侦听到信道将被占用NAV值指示的时间,开始倒计时知道NAV时间结束。在NAV时间还没有结束之前,节点认为信道出于忙碌状态,既不会向网络中别的节点发送数据包,也不会尝试去监听信道。 MAC帧中的Dur/ID字段字段有16bits长度,所以能表示的最大数值为65535,因此一次RTS/CTS可以申请的最长时间为65535us。图2-1 NAV设置与RTS/CTSIEEE802.11采用CSMA/CA机制,加入了ACK控制报文来实现链路层的确认。它采用载波监听机制,节点在发送报文之前先监听信道的忙闲状况。如果信道空闲并持续一个DIFS时间,就开始i发送报文:如果信道忙或在DIFS内信道便忙,就执行退避算法,计算一个随机的退避时间,一直等到信道空闲,并持续空闲DIFS时间后,节点开始以时隙为单位递减退避时间。如果递减到0,节点就开始发送报文;如果在递减过程中信道变忙,节点就冻结退避时间,等待信道空闲并持续空闲了DIFS时间后继续递减。NAV值的设置机制如图2-1所示。3. 结论 802.11标准中,在物理层对无线介质信道进行空闲评估实施物理信道侦听,MAC层使用网路分配向量来预估对WM的占用状态实施虚拟侦听,并认为这两种侦听,只要任何一种侦听指示信道忙,均可以认为是无线介质忙。802.11中定义的二元侦听机制较好的客服了无线信道空闲侦听这一难题。 参考文献 1 雷维礼,马立香,彭美娥. 局域网与城域网. 人民邮电出版社 2 IEEE 802.11-2007:Wireless LAN Medium Access Control(MAC)and Physical Layer(PHY)Specifications 3 李磊,易平 两次更新NAV防止抢占攻击的研究 Netinfo Security 2011(12) 4 李勇 CSMA_CA MAC退避攻击与防御研究 电子科技大学硕士论文 2009操懈皂贵瑰轿抄野草柏栖奖斯坚蘸雄阮伏狙点依疫谤熟葡梅芦忌很戚脑整糟液挣嫌慕投相惰刃此现缎蔫替治方眶徒材疫他童卡勺码雹廖仿怕尾乏疲慈阳振硕伤晤癣瓷喘喊敛喻膛武冗幂裤颤硅授错军兔乓估播锨趋坯吩雏赛肢镰织仿幂槽絮妨曳录巧腰喘晾谦漠钙摆云譬朵漂禁窜惋损镁坑禾帮甜厦戴廊幼捞伺刁裔莎彪如拎甚巴教夸窘沾鄙漆彤赖东废守疡续梗帐貉可果滁邦辙食橇菜酱挠桃乡梢允馋贺顶唤运党陈脾哲禾与随斟畜上秸沧危咖痹茬朋部亮株玄核坪敢适骨是地笛且闰蠕凯鬼授凰择士毁跋序镭嫁抄挝拂嗡耳坑采逼窑峨捻挽挥墨嚏立梨搏膊谅怂啼甄咆虑澳裂逗窥份垒颓呐悼亏竭褥IEEE802.11的载波侦听技术分析偿矗矣昨杉艇酋顷酞瓣咋探冈鹊冈擦诬廓睹齿市兹适卸唾贩暑窑届芯躁泰蛊基梦攘奥凳埠设团泌绢所闻温砰腕霄负厄胃嘴咕巳爪鼎且华推塘订坦懈雀莎泵润煞尚敲沽楞肺反轻俄澎剔配秉怂项办裸应露新错刷尘踩墅椎徐饵眺论孰谱四蔽家给安挑盅慑院享央综碰菊尾私躬姐蛔喘挺港椿安绘似扮汪磕掌愤额钠沈辐亮掇查敲聘园氦眉晃臼荐摄吱云淬僧桌宦姑它迹锈芒凯降疮逆扔烫她冶桂辱恩铜缠信到厨根碎馋任筛顽设殊喘宵冲烟砍侗浆冉玛虹华蠢弓调二眉韩弧墨椅扯框蜕笛墒获啮馈笆旺区黄恬远掩狭臻师谈琼棕哄溯狭袒拽旷影政遏孽胜竖枣毫婚姻贮收苔持闹茹证酉翠斥吉址虫踏衬状竿IEEE 802.11的载波侦听技术分析2 IEEE 802.11的载波侦听技术分析摘要 作为一种MAC层接入控制协议,载波侦听多路访问冲突避免(Carrier Sense Multiple Access wit
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 红酒仓储知识培训内容课件
- 2025年住宅区房产买卖合同协议书
- 2025合同范本:初创企业股东权益协议书详细明确可供借鉴模板
- 询问天气课件
- 我的不倒翁250字12篇范文
- 农业生产经营共同出资协议
- 红楼梦黛玉进贾府课件
- 红楼梦课件每回思维导图
- 农业生产环境监测技术服务合同
- 红楼梦课件三十到四十回
- 2025云南咖啡购销合同范本
- 中职导游业务课件
- 园区卫生清洁管理办法
- 秋季养生课件中医
- 申报书范例《毛泽东思想和中国特色社会主义理论体系概论》在线课程申报书课件
- 闵行区2024-2025学年下学期七年级数学期末考试试卷及答案(上海新教材沪教版)
- DB1331∕T 034-2022 建筑与市政工程无障碍设计图集
- 中信集团协同管理制度
- 军事信息技术课件及教案
- 2025至2030年中国重组人促红素行业市场调查分析及投资发展潜力报告
- 2025-2030中国引航船行业市场发展趋势与前景展望战略研究报告
评论
0/150
提交评论